Disabled persons The Charity's policy is to recruit disabled workers for those vacancies that they are able to fill and all necessary assistance with initial training courses is provided. Arrangements are made, whenever possible, for retraining employees who become disabled, to enable them to perform Wof k identified as appropriate to their aptitudes and abilities. Directors, responsibilities statement The Directors are responsible for preparing the Strategic Report, the Directors, Report and the financial statements in accordance with applicable law and regulations. Company law requires the Directors to prepare financial statements for each financial year. Under that law the Directors have elected to prepare the financial statements in accordance with UK Generally Accepted Accounting Practice IUK Accounting Standards and applicable lawl. Under company law the Directors must not approve the financial statements unless they are satisfied that they give a true and fair view of the state of affairs of the Charity and the profit or loss of the Charity for that financial year. rkASM

Northern Counties Development Association - Financial statements for the year ended 31 January 2024 Directors, Report Page S In preparing these financial statements, the Directors are required to: select suitable accounting policies and then apply them consistently; make judgements and accounting estimates that are reasonable and prudent,. state whether applicable UK Accounting Standards have been followed, subject to any material departures, disclosed and explained in the financial statements,. and prepare the financial statements on the going concern basis unless it is inappropriate to presume that the Charity will continue in business. The Directors are responsible for keeping adequate accounting records that are sufficient to show and explain the Charity's transactions and disclose with reasonable accuracy at any time the financial position of the Charity and enable them to ensure that the financial statements comply with the Companies Act 2006. The Directors are also responsible for safeguarding the assets of the Charity and hence for taking reasonable steps for the prevention and detection of fraud and other irregularities.
